No matter what the sport, you need the right equipment if you’re going to play your best. And that’s exactly why the Honda CRF125F Big Wheel is such an important bike. It strikes the perfect balance between size and power for many growing riders.
We start by taking our CRF125F and add a longer swingarm and larger diameter wheels. That raises the seat height by two inches, making it a better fit for taller riders. The proven single-cylinder engine features fuel injection for broader power and better running in cold weather and high altitudes. There’s also a four-speed transmission and a twin-spar steel frame, along with plenty of suspension travel for a plush ride. You even get an electric starter! COMFORTWith a 19-inch front wheel and a 16-inch wheel in the rear, the CRF125F Big Wheel will fit taller riders a little better. The right-sized bike is as important as wearing the right-sized boots or helmet.
Just like the pros use, the CRF125F Big Wheel gets half-waffle pattern grips. Might as well start them off right!
PERFORMANCEThe CRF125F Big Wheel’s dependable four-stroke single-cylinder engine offers good performance with a wide powerband—perfect for a wide range of riders, including beginners. Fuel injection makes it even better and more efficient.
HANDLINGHonda's heavy-duty clutch is durable and helps promote smooth shifting.
ENGINEERINGThe four-speed gearbox is just like a full-sized motorcycle’s, giving your younger rider all the control they need.
Less experienced riders are hard on equipment, especially when they’re just starting out. That’s why we gave the CRF125F Big Wheel a strong, twin-spar-type steel frame and swingarm that are built to handle the bumps and dings of off-road riding.
CONVENIENCEPush-button starting makes getting started easier in all kinds of conditions, and the efficient design adds minimal weight.
For added security, the keyed ignition switch lets you control who goes riding and when, important if you have younger riders in the house.
